当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

两台服务器怎么做集群信息互通,两台服务器集群信息互通指南

两台服务器怎么做集群信息互通,两台服务器集群信息互通指南

两台服务器集群信息互通是构建高可用性和高性能网络环境的关键步骤,本文将详细介绍如何实现两台服务器的信息互通,包括硬件连接、软件配置和网络设置等方面,通过合理规划和管理,...

两台服务器集群信息互通是构建高可用性和高性能网络环境的关键步骤,本文将详细介绍如何实现两台服务器的信息互通,包括硬件连接、软件配置和网络设置等方面,通过合理规划和管理,确保数据传输的稳定性和可靠性。,我们需要确认两台服务器的操作系统和硬件规格是否兼容,以确保它们能够正常工作并相互通信,在物理层面上,使用以太网电缆或光纤连接两台服务器,确保网络线路的质量和稳定性。,我们需要配置网络参数,如IP地址、子网掩码等,以便于服务器之间识别对方并进行数据交换,还需要考虑网络安全问题,例如防火墙规则和数据加密等措施来保护敏感信息不被未经授权的用户访问。,我们可以利用负载均衡技术来实现多台服务器的协同工作,提高系统的整体性能和处理能力,定期监控和维护也是保持系统稳定运行的重要手段之一。,实现两台服务器集群的信息互通需要综合考虑多个因素,包括硬件选择、网络配置和安全措施等,只有做好这些准备工作,才能确保我们的系统能够高效、安全地运行下去。

在当今数字化时代,构建高效、稳定的服务器集群是许多企业和开发者面临的重要任务之一,本文将详细介绍如何实现两台服务器的集群信息互通,确保数据同步和系统的高可用性。

随着互联网技术的飞速发展,企业对数据处理能力和系统可靠性的要求越来越高,为了满足这些需求,越来越多的企业开始采用服务器集群技术来提高系统的性能和稳定性,本文旨在为读者提供一个详细的指导,帮助他们理解并实施两台服务器的集群信息互通方案。

准备工作

在进行服务器集群信息互通之前,我们需要做好充分的准备工作:

两台服务器怎么做集群信息互通,两台服务器集群信息互通指南

图片来源于网络,如有侵权联系删除

  1. 硬件准备:选择合适的物理或虚拟服务器,确保它们具备足够的计算资源和存储能力。
  2. 操作系统安装:在同一平台上安装相同版本的操作系统(如Linux),以便于后续配置和管理。
  3. 网络环境搭建:确保两台服务器之间能够通过局域网进行通信,并且有足够带宽支持数据的传输。

配置网络设置

在网络设置方面,我们需要确保两台服务器之间的网络连接畅通无阻,这包括以下步骤:

  1. IP地址分配:为每台服务器分配唯一的IP地址,并在路由器上进行相应的配置以保持网络的连通性。
  2. 子网掩码设定:确定子网掩码,使得同一子网内的设备可以直接通信而不需要经过外部网络。
  3. DNS解析:如果需要在Internet上访问集群中的某个服务,则需要正确配置域名解析记录。

部署负载均衡器

为了进一步提高系统的可扩展性和容错能力,我们可以在前端部署一个负载均衡器来分发流量到不同的服务器上,常用的负载均衡算法有轮询、加权轮询等,以下是使用Nginx作为负载均衡器的示例配置:

http {
    upstream backend {
        server 192.168.1.101;
        server 192.168.1.102;
    }
    server {
        listen 80;
        location / {
            proxy_pass http://backend;
            proxy_set_header Host $host;
            proxy_set_header X-Real-IP $remote_addr;
            pro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
        }
    }
}

数据库同步与备份策略

对于关键业务的数据,通常需要进行实时的数据同步和定期的数据备份,这里以MySQL为例介绍其复制机制和数据备份方法:

数据库复制

  1. 主从模式:在一台服务器上启动MySQL的主服务器实例,另一台服务器上启动从服务器实例。
  2. 配置复制
    • 在主服务器上启用二进制日志文件(binlog)记录所有操作;
    • 在从服务器上指定要复制的binlog文件位置和ID;
    • 启动从服务器并进行必要的权限授予。

数据备份

定期执行全量备份和增量备份可以有效保护数据安全,可以使用以下命令进行备份:

mysqldump -u root -p密码 --all-databases > backup.sql

监控与报警系统

建立一个有效的监控系统可以帮助及时发现潜在问题并进行处理,常用的开源监控工具包括Zabbix、Prometheus等,下面简要介绍如何在Zabbix中添加监控项:

两台服务器怎么做集群信息互通,两台服务器集群信息互通指南

图片来源于网络,如有侵权联系删除

  1. 安装Zabbix Server:在任意一台服务器上安装Zabbix Server组件。
  2. 添加主机:在Web界面中添加待监控的服务器作为新主机。
  3. 创建模板:定义各种监控参数如CPU使用率、内存占用、磁盘空间等。
  4. 触发警报:当监测到的值超出预设阈值时,自动发送通知给管理员。

安全措施

为确保集群的安全性,必须采取一系列的安全措施:

  1. 防火墙规则:合理配置iptables或ufw等防火墙软件,限制不必要的端口访问。
  2. SSL/TLS加密:对所有外部的HTTP/HTTPS请求进行TLS加密传输,防止中间人攻击。
  3. 账户管理:严格管理账号权限,避免越权操作;定期更换密码和使用强密码策略。
  4. 日志审计:记录所有的登录尝试和重要操作日志,便于事后追踪和分析。

持续优化与维护

即使已经完成了上述所有步骤,也不能认为工作就此结束,相反,应该不断地关注新技术的发展趋势,及时更新和维护现有系统以确保其长期稳定运行。

  1. 性能调优:定期检查各服务器的资源利用率,并根据实际情况调整相关参数以提高效率。
  2. 故障排查:遇到问题时迅速定位原因并进行修复,同时总结经验教训以预防类似问题的再次发生。
  3. 版本升级:遵循官方发布的更新公告,适时地对操作系统和应用软件进行安全补丁的打补丁操作。

通过以上详细而全面的讲解,相信大家已经掌握了如何实现两台服务器的集群

黑狐家游戏

发表评论

最新文章